In the second volume of this sweeping saga, the intricacies of feudal Japan come alive through the eyes of an outsider, a foreigner caught between two worlds. As the protagonist navigates the treacherous waters of political intrigue and cultural differences, he must also confront his own beliefs and desires. Clavell’s rich and immersive narrative draws readers into a landscape filled with honor, betrayal, and the stubborn clash of tradition versus change.
The story delves deeper into the lives of samurais, warlords, and the Eastern philosophies that define their existence. The complexities of loyalty and honor take center stage as alliances shift and rivalries simmer. Against a backdrop of breathtaking landscapes and vivid characters, Clavell builds a world where the stakes are as high as the honor codes that govern these formidable warriors.
Amidst the drama, unexpected friendships bloom, and romance intertwines with conflict, creating an emotional tapestry that resonates with humanity’s most fundamental struggles. The characters’ journeys are both individual and collective, illustrating how personal ambitions can clash with the greater good.
From gripping battle scenes to moments of profound introspection, this volume not only unravel the mysteries of 17th-century Japan but also encourages a deeper exploration of identity and belonging. Through masterful storytelling, readers are invited to reflect on the intricate dance of power and the timeless pursuit of understanding in a world forever changing.
